Hydraulic Cement: Hydraulic cement accounts for 15% of the bulk cement market, driven by its ability to set and harden in wet conditions, making it essential for repair and infrastructure projects contributing 48% of demand. Bulk cement distribution represents 58% of supply in this segment, improving efficiency in large-scale operations. Commercial applications account for 40% of hydraulic cement usage, while industrial projects contribute 35% and residential applications represent 25%. Rapid-setting properties reduce construction time by 23%, improving project efficiency. Asia-Pacific holds 55% of hydraulic cement consumption, followed by Europe at 20% and North America at 15%. Water-resistant properties enhance durability by 27%, making it suitable for marine and underground construction. Ready-mix applications account for 62% of hydraulic cement usage, while on-site applications represent 38%. Additionally, infrastructure repair projects influence 32% of demand, supporting ongoing maintenance of aging structures globally.
Alumina Cement Alumina cement represents 5% of the bulk cement market, used in specialized applications requiring high temperature resistance and rapid strength development. Industrial applications contribute 45% of demand, particularly in refractory linings and chemical plants, while infrastructure projects account for 28% and commercial construction represents 27%. Bulk cement distribution accounts for 50% of supply, reflecting its use in large-scale industrial projects. Heat resistance properties improve durability by 30%, making it suitable for extreme environments. Asia-Pacific leads consumption with 50% share, followed by Europe at 22% and North America at 16%. Rapid hardening properties reduce construction time by 21%, supporting efficient project execution. Precast and specialized construction applications account for 33% of usage. Additionally, storage and handling systems are used in 48% of alumina cement projects, ensuring consistent supply and minimizing material loss by 16%.
